云服务器免费试用

TreeNode在二叉树中的作用是什么

服务器知识 0 312

TreeNode 在二叉树中是一个基本的数据结构,用于表示二叉树中的每个节点。每个 TreeNode 包含两个指针,通常称为左子节点(left)和右子节点(right),以及一个值(value)。这些指针用于连接和组织二叉树中的节点,从而形成一个层次结构。

TreeNode在二叉树中的作用是什么

在二叉树中,TreeNode 的作用主要有以下几点:

  1. 存储数据:TreeNode 可以存储任意类型的数据,例如整数、字符串等。这使得二叉树可以用于解决各种问题,如排序、查找、表达式求值等。

  2. 连接节点:TreeNode 的左子节点和右子节点指针用于连接其他 TreeNode,从而形成一个层次结构。这使得二叉树可以表示复杂的关系,如树形结构、堆等。

  3. 遍历:通过 TreeNode 的指针,可以方便地遍历整个二叉树。常见的遍历方法有前序遍历、中序遍历和后序遍历。

  4. 操作:TreeNode 可以用于执行各种操作,如插入、删除、查找等。这些操作通常需要遍历二叉树,并根据特定条件进行节点的添加、删除或修改。

总之,TreeNode 在二叉树中起到了关键作用,它是组织和操作二叉树的基本单元。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942@q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: TreeNode在二叉树中的作用是什么
本文地址: https://solustack.com/171190.html

相关推荐:

网友留言:

我要评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。